General Info
In Block
593acd3387122c0bed843d0134caf7e6662f7682ec08b2b50984e831d99fcd3e
In block height
Total Input
2373923.05643701 RDD
Total Output
2375751.30625213 RDD
Transaction Details
Fee
0 RDD
mined Thu, 26 May 2022 14:13:44 UTC
From
2373923.05643701 RDD